"Snow White And The Huntsman" (2012)

Plot: IMDb

In a twist to the fairy tale, the Huntsman ordered to take Snow White into the woods to be killed winds up becoming her protector and mentor in a quest to vanquish the Evil Queen.

Phantom's Review: First the good things, Charlize Theron is excellent as the evil queen. The movie is beautifully filmed, it has a kind of "Lord Of The Rings"style going for it. Some good special FX and fine action scenes.
The Bad things: Sadly, the worst thing about the movie is Snow White herself. Kristen Stewarts vacant, dead behind the eyes stare gave her a look of somebody who is perpetually stoned. Her acting abilities are non existent and she has the emotional range of a paper bag. I have never seen her before in a movie and if this is the best she can do, then I truly don't understand her popularity. This is a film that should have been great but instead is only OK.

Basket Case 3-The Progeny (1992) This was ok but not as essential as the first two films-I guess the joke starts to wear thin at this point and some of it's best scenes are spoiled with a less sharp script than expected. Only for Henenlotter fans.

Night Warning/Butcher Baker Nightmare Maker/The Evil Protege (1982). One of the few video nasties I hadn't seen and it was definitely worth hunting it down. The version I saw was the VHS R Rated one so I guess there may have been cuts. Nevertheless this is quite a hidden gem. Controversial with plenty of taboo breaking subject matter and believeable characters. For once I actually hated the characters the viewer was supposed to hate and liked the ones the viewer is supposed to like. Quite a unique little film that towards the end transcends its low budget. Not shocking really nowadays but definitely worth seeing.
